Monitoring
The issues seen with emails and attachments are a result of a change we made to file handling last night. We have reversed this change whilst we investigate and resolve the remaining issues.

You may have seen emails with attachments not being sent to the dropbox, inbound emails with attachments not appearing on the lead, problems adding attachments to email templates and attachments not showing on emails. Only emails with attachments were affected.

We are currently completing a re-sync on files created in the system, including email attachments, between 22.00 last night (Tuesday 31st March) when the change was made and 11.40 today (Wednesday 1st April) when it was reversed. Until this is completed, you may continue to see the above problems. We'll tell you once everything is back to normal.
